Does Dippin’ Daisy’s Run Small?

In general, Dippin’ Daisy’s runs true to US sizing, but compared to UK high street brands, many styles may feel smaller:

  • Bikini tops often run small in coverage, especially triangle and bralette styles.

  • Bottoms vary: cheeky cuts and high-rise fits often feel snug.

  • One-pieces have less torso length than many UK brands.

  • Loungewear and dresses are true to size, but lightweight fabrics can fit closer to the body.

Because most Dippin’ Daisy’s items come in XS–XL, it’s best to choose based on actual bust, waist and hip measurements, not just your dress size.

Popular Dippin’ Daisy’s Styles & How They Fit

1. High Cut Bottoms (e.g., The Kai, The Willow)

  • Designed to sit above the hip with cheeky or Brazilian back coverage.

  • Runs snug—especially on curvier body types.

  • If in doubt, size up or opt for more coverage styles.


2. Triangle & Scoop Tops (e.g., The Phoebe, The Ivy)

  • Triangle tops are minimal in coverage, best for smaller busts.

  • Scoop styles offer slightly more support but are not structured.

  • No underwire—measure bust accurately before ordering.

3. One-Piece Swimsuits

  • Stylish and sculpting, but can run short in the torso.

  • High-leg cuts may feel more revealing than expected.

  • Check your height and torso length in Tellar to avoid sizing surprises.


4. Dresses, Cover-Ups & Loungewear

  • Lightweight and casual fit, mostly true to size.

  • Some cuts are flowy, others more fitted—fabric stretch varies.

  • Elastic waists and straps give some flexibility, but bust fit matters.

Common Mistakes When Buying Dippin’ Daisy’s

Post Image

  1. Using your UK dress size – US sizing differs, and Dippin’ Daisy’s runs small in some pieces.

  2. Choosing based on bra size alone – Triangle and scoop tops offer little structural support.

  3. Assuming all styles have the same fit – Fabric, cut and coverage vary across collections.

  4. Not checking torso length – Crucial for one-pieces and active swimwear.
